Diagnostic codes on an RTHD chiller are generally grouped by how they affect the unit's operation: Informational
: These do not stop the chiller but notify the operator of a specific state or minor deviation. Latching Shutdowns
: These require a manual reset after the fault is cleared before the chiller can restart. Examples often include high-pressure cutouts or motor protection trips Non-Latching Shutdowns
: The chiller will automatically restart once the condition that caused the code returns to a normal range (e.g., low water flow that later resumes). Accessing Codes
